A plaque commemorates the 2015 ANZAC Day.
ANZAC Day, 25 April, is one of Australia’s most important national occasions. It marks the anniversary of the first major military action fought by Australian and New Zealand forces during the First World War.

Front Inscription
The Landing At Gallipoli Of
Australian And New Zealand Soldiers
Took Place On April 25 1915.
This Event Created The Word "ANZAC"
And A Century Later
This Plaque Commemorates ANZAC Day April 25 2015
